Extremely robust: SCHOTT Solar presents new generation of double-glass modules

* SCHOTT ASI double-glass module now with even greater performance stability and longer life * New high performer available from February The new addition to the SCHOTT Solar product family is doubly good – in every sense of the term: Thanks to its tried-and-tested thin film technology and its sturdy double-glass construction, this module is a high performer with a long life, generating high solar returns even in conditions of diffuse sunlight and a non-optimum roof orientation.

The double glass makes the module even more resistant to environmental influences of any kind. The new photovoltaic module will be available to buy from February.

The improved SCHOTT ASI double-glass module is a further development of the company’s existing glass-foil module, utilising the tried-and-tested double-glass technology developed and optimised at SCHOTT Solar’s Jena and Alzenau sites. Its double-glass construction means the module is even more resistant to environmental influences of any kind. This makes it an ideal product for agricultural applications, where aggressive air pollutants such as ammonia vapours are a significant issue – a fact confirmed by the seal of quality for ammonia resistance issued by the German Agricultural Society (DLG).

The SCHOTT ASI double-glass module can be used universally – for both roof and ground-mounted applications. Additionally, this all-rounder generates high solar returns even where sunlight is diffuse, in warm or badly ventilated locations or where roof orientation is less than ideal. And there are still more benefits: The module is a very economical option thanks to its low price per square metre and watt-peak, while its refined relay system allows it to be used for higher performance classes, up to 107 W. The new SCHOTT ASI double-glass module is fitted with two single-phase junction boxes and an LC4 plug connector made by Lumberg. SCHOTT Solar’s commitment to reducing the presence of harmful substances in the environment is reflected in SCHOTT ASI modules’ compliance with the European RoHS directive (Restriction of the use of certain hazardous substances), which restricts the use of particular hazardous substances in electric and electronic devices and the use of dangerous substances in devices and component parts generally.

SCHOTT ASI double-glass modules carry a 30-year linear performance guarantee, meaning solar system operators can trust in them to generate high returns. SCHOTT ASI modules are certified by TÜV Rheinland (German Technical Inspection Authority Rhineland) as conforming to IEC 61646 ed. 2 and IEC 61730, electrical protection class II and the CE standards.
